Hi all,

Quick wrap-up on last night's cut-over: the Thistledown gateway now fronts the upstream Orvan API with a proper circuit breaker. If Orvan misbehaves, your plugins will get fast-fail responses instead of hanging requests, so handle the new error code gracefully. Retries are budgeted per caller now, not global. The breaker went live with the settings shown here.

service settings:
[pelius]
port = 5432
team = praius
host = pelius.crelvoforge.internal
region = upper-4
access_code = ac_8f224d
timeout_ms = 2000

**Bulk edits — Gridvane admin table**

Plugin authors: bulk edits bypass row-level hooks. Your plugin will NOT receive per-row events during a bulk operation. Subscribe to the batch-complete event instead and reconcile afterward. Limit reconciliation queries to the affected ID range; full scans get throttled. Never write directly to the audit table — use the provided batch API. For local testing, spin up the sandbox instance and point your plugin at it using the connection string below.

replica DSN, kajep-yahag: mssql://praok_svc:iF@db-8d68.plorvaio.local:5432/eliion

In-house team retains escalations and enterprise accounts. Department heads must identify affected processes and nominate a transition lead by Friday. No external communication until the formal announcement; refer press or partner queries to corporate affairs. Training and knowledge-transfer schedules follow next week. Costs sit with central operations, not departmental budgets. The confidential plan behind this move is set out below.

confidential, kagep-kahof: Druokax Systems plans to lower the Ulaath list price by 53 percent in March.